Let’s start with the basics. A pump casing is like the protective shell of a pump. It houses all the important parts and helps direct the flow of fluid. Volutes, on the other hand, are the spiral – shaped passages in the casing that convert the kinetic energy of the fluid into pressure energy. Now, there are two main types of volute designs: single – volute and double – volute, and each has its own set of features.

2. Efficiency at Design Conditions
Single – volute pump casings are really good at operating efficiently under design conditions. When the pump is running at its optimal flow rate and pressure, the single – volute design can effectively convert the kinetic energy of the fluid into pressure energy. The smooth, single – spiral passage allows the fluid to flow in a more direct path, reducing energy losses due to turbulence.
This means that the pump uses less energy to move the same amount of fluid compared to some other designs. For industries where energy consumption is a major cost factor, such as water treatment plants or manufacturing facilities, a single – volute pump can lead to significant savings in the long run. Comparing with Double – Volute Designs
Now, let’s take a look at how single – volute designs stack up against double – volute designs. Double – volute casings are often used in applications where the pump needs to operate over a wide range of flow rates. They are better at reducing radial forces on the pump shaft, which can help extend the life of the pump bearings.
However, this comes at a cost. Double – volute designs are more complex and more expensive to manufacture. They also tend to be larger in size, which can be a drawback in space – constrained applications. And because of their complexity, maintenance can be more difficult and time – consuming.
In many cases, if your pump is going to operate mainly at or near its design conditions, a single – volute pump casing is the better choice. It offers the right balance of efficiency, cost – effectiveness, and ease of maintenance.
